What is the Men Ski Mask?

The Men Ski Mask is a balaclava-style ski mask that covers the entire face and head, leaving only the eyes and mouth exposed. It is usually made of a thick, warm material such as fleece or wool, and often comes in bright colors or funky patterns.

How to Choose a Men Ski Mask

When choosing a Men Ski Mask, there are a few things to keep in mind. Firstly, consider the material – you want something that is warm and comfortable against your skin. Secondly, think about the style – do you want something plain and practical, or something bright and eye-catching? Finally, make sure the mask fits well and covers your entire head and face comfortably.

How to Care for Your Men Ski Mask

To keep your Men Ski Mask in good condition, be sure to wash it regularly (following the care instructions on the label) and store it in a dry, cool place. Avoid exposing it to extreme heat or sunlight, which can cause fading or damage to the material.

Men Ski Mask: To Wear or Not to Wear

The Pros of Men Ski Mask

1. Protection from the cold: Men ski masks are designed to keep your face and neck warm during cold weather conditions. This will help prevent frostbite and hypothermia.
2. Sun protection: Men ski masks can also protect your skin from sunburns while skiing or snowboarding in sunny conditions.
3. Fashion statement: Some men wear ski masks as a fashion statement, particularly those who are into streetwear fashion. A ski mask can make you look like a cool ninja or a bank robber (hopefully not the latter!).

The Cons of Men Ski Mask

1. Limited vision: Wearing a ski mask can limit your peripheral vision, which can be dangerous when skiing or snowboarding. You may not see other skiers or obstacles on the slopes.
2. Intimidating: Let's face it, wearing a ski mask can make you look intimidating, especially if you're wearing all black. You may scare off potential friends or romantic interests.
3. Uncomfortable: Some men find ski masks uncomfortable to wear, especially if they have facial hair. The mask may rub against their beard or mustache and cause irritation.

The Verdict

So, should you wear a men ski mask? It depends on your personal preference and needs. If you're skiing in extremely cold weather and want to protect your face and neck, then a ski mask is a good choice. However, if you're skiing in sunny conditions or want to avoid limiting your vision, then skip the ski mask.
